To preprocess data: ./download.sh python3 -m squad.prepro
To run training: python3 -m bidaf.cli --mode train
To debug: python3 -m bidaf.cli --mode train --debug
directory structure: /my: util files /bidaf: bidaf training / testing files /squad: squad dataset preprocessing files
